After decades in international and Indian public service, N.K. Singh is currently a Member of Rajya Sabha (the Upper House of Parliament) from the State of Bihar. Mr. Singh has held senior civil service positions in the Ministries of Finance – Economic Affairs, Expenditure & Revenue Secretary- as well as in the Ministry of Home Affairs. He served as Secretary to the Prime Minister and was a Member of the National Planning Commission as well as Deputy Chairman of the Bihar State Planning Board.

Mr. Singh has held advisory and leadership positions at the United Nations. He represented India in successive delegations to the World Bank, International Monetary Fund, Asian Development Bank, World Intellectual Property Organization and United Nations Development Programme. He served as the Minister (Economic and Commercial) at the Indian Embassy in Tokyo during a critical time in the countries' bilateral relationship. Mr. Singh is an economist by training. He graduated in economics from St. Stephens College, Delhi and went on to do his Masters from the Delhi School of Economics before becoming an IAS Officer.  He is a regular panelist and faculty member at the World Economic Forum, a frequent lecturer at Universities around the world, and a regular contributor on economic and policy matters to the Indian Express, Financial Express and Hindustan Times among other media outlets.

As a Member of Parliament, Mr. Singh is a member of the Public Accounts Committee, the Committee on Public Undertakings, the Standing Committee on Education, Parliamentary Consultative Committee on Finance and Parliamentary Forum on Global Warming & Climate Change. He serves on the board of premium research organizations like ICRIER (Indian Council for Research and International Economic Relations), International Management Institute, Observer Research Foundation, and is co-Chairman of the India Advisory Board of London School of Economics and member of the India Advisory Board of Columbia University. He is Member of the Governing Board, Nalanda International University. Mr. Singh is fond of photography, horticulture, and Indian Classical music. He is married to Prem Kumari, and has three children, Meenakshi, Abhijeet and Madhavi.
